If you have sudden, severe pelvic pain … gateway urgent care gilbert azWebJun 21, 2003 · Only ovarian cysts at risk of complication are to be considered. They are essentially ovarian cysts which, whatever their echogenic features, have a size > or =6 cm. Their prevalence is estimated between 0.5 and 2 per thousand of pregnancies.
